kvm虚拟机万兆网卡配置,KVM虚拟机深度解析,万兆网卡配置攻略,实现高速网络体验
- 综合资讯
- 2025-04-02 19:21:09
- 2

本文深入解析KVM虚拟机配置万兆网卡的方法,详细介绍了万兆网卡配置攻略,帮助用户实现高速网络体验。...
本文深入解析KVM虚拟机配置万兆网卡的方法,详细介绍了万兆网卡配置攻略,帮助用户实现高速网络体验。
随着云计算、大数据等技术的快速发展,虚拟化技术已成为企业IT架构的重要组成部分,KVM作为开源的虚拟化技术,以其高性能、低成本等优势,在虚拟化领域占据了一席之地,在KVM虚拟机中,万兆网卡配置对于提升网络性能至关重要,本文将详细介绍KVM虚拟机万兆网卡配置方法,帮助您实现高速网络体验。
KVM虚拟机万兆网卡配置步骤
硬件准备
在配置KVM虚拟机万兆网卡之前,请确保您的服务器具备以下硬件条件:
(1)物理服务器:支持PCI-E插槽,可安装万兆网卡。
图片来源于网络,如有侵权联系删除
(2)万兆网卡:具备高速网络传输能力。
(3)操作系统:支持KVM虚拟化技术的操作系统,如CentOS、Ubuntu等。
安装KVM虚拟化软件
以CentOS为例,安装KVM虚拟化软件的步骤如下:
(1)打开终端,执行以下命令安装EPEL仓库:
sudo yum install epel-release
(2)安装KVM软件包:
sudo yum install libvirt libvirt-python libguestfs-tools virt-install
(3)安装KVM内核模块:
sudo yum install kvm-kmod
(4)启动并使能KVM服务:
sudo systemctl start libvirtd
sudo systemctl enable libvirtd
配置万兆网卡
(1)查看物理网卡信息
我们需要查看物理服务器的网卡信息,确认万兆网卡是否已正确安装,在终端执行以下命令:
ip a
(2)创建网络桥接
为了将物理网卡与虚拟机进行连接,我们需要创建一个网络桥接,在终端执行以下命令:
sudo brctl addbr br0
sudo brctl addif br0 eth0
br0
为创建的网络桥接名称,eth0
为物理网卡名称。
(3)配置网络参数
图片来源于网络,如有侵权联系删除
我们需要配置网络参数,包括IP地址、子网掩码、网关等,在终端执行以下命令:
sudo vi /etc/sysconfig/network-scripts/ifcfg-br0
添加到文件中:
TYPE=Bridge
PROXY_METHOD=none
BROWSER_ONLY=no
BOOTPROTO=static
DEFROUTE=yes
IPV4_FAILURE_FATAL=no
IPV6INIT=no
IPV6_AUTOCONF=no
IPV6_DEFROUTE=no
IPV6_FAILURE_FATAL=no
IPV6_ADDR_GEN_MODE=stable-privacy
NAME=br0
UUID=8a9c8b6c-5b6a-4a7c-8c39-5e5e5e5e5e5e
DEVICE=br0
ONBOOT=yes
IPADDR=192.168.1.100
NETMASK=255.255.255.0
GATEWAY=192.168.1.1
(4)重启网络服务
配置完成后,重启网络服务使配置生效:
sudo systemctl restart network
创建虚拟机并配置网络
(1)创建虚拟机
在终端执行以下命令创建虚拟机:
virt-install --name vm1 --ram 2048 --vcpus 2 --disk path=/var/lib/libvirt/images/vm1.img,size=20 --os-type linux --os-variant fedora28 --graphics none --console pty,target_type=serial --network bridge=br0,model=virtio
vm1
为虚拟机名称,ram
为内存大小,vcpus
为CPU核心数,disk
为磁盘路径和大小,os-type
和os-variant
为操作系统类型和版本,graphics
和console
为图形界面和终端类型,network
为网络配置。
(2)配置虚拟机网络
在虚拟机中,我们需要配置网络参数,使其能够连接到物理网络,在终端执行以下命令:
sudo vi /etc/sysconfig/network-scripts/ifcfg-eth0
添加到文件中:
TYPE=Ethernet
PROXY_METHOD=none
BROWSER_ONLY=no
BOOTPROTO=static
DEFROUTE=yes
IPV4_FAILURE_FATAL=no
IPV6INIT=no
IPV6_AUTOCONF=no
IPV6_DEFROUTE=no
IPV6_FAILURE_FATAL=no
IPV6_ADDR_GEN_MODE=stable-privacy
NAME=eth0
UUID=8a9c8b6c-5b6a-4a7c-8c39-5e5e5e5e5e5e
DEVICE=eth0
ONBOOT=yes
IPADDR=192.168.1.101
NETMASK=255.255.255.0
GATEWAY=192.168.1.1
配置完成后,重启网络服务:
sudo systemctl restart network
本文详细介绍了KVM虚拟机万兆网卡配置方法,包括硬件准备、安装KVM虚拟化软件、配置网络桥接、配置网络参数以及创建虚拟机并配置网络,通过以上步骤,您可以在KVM虚拟机中实现高速网络体验,希望本文对您有所帮助。
本文链接:https://zhitaoyun.cn/1981647.html
发表评论